Major Cyber Attack On Jammu Municipal Corporation Website, Critical Data Stolen By Hackers

In a major cyber attack on the Jammu Municipal Corporation website on Friday, critical data was stolen by hackers, top intelligence sources said.

All certificates and databases, likely containing citizen data like Aadhaar numbers, property records, tax details and administrative documents, and infrastructure plans, were reportedly lost in the data breach incident, sources added.

The agencies are working to restore the website.

“Such attacks align with patterns of Pakistan-backed cyber operations aimed at destabilising Indian administrative infrastructure. This is deliberately done, particularly in sensitive regions like Jammu and Kashmir,” sources said.

Further details on the matter are awaited.

Previous Hacking Attempts By Pakistan

Earlier yesterday, Pakistan-sponsored hacker groups such as ‘Cyber Group HOAX1337’ and ‘National Cyber Crew’ made unsuccessful attempts to hack some Indian websites. Their attempts were foiled by the cybersecurity agencies as they promptly identified and neutralised the threats.
